Location: Carseview Centre, Dundee

Position: General Adult Psychiatry - Part time (30 hours) Occupational Therapy Support Worker - Band 3

Salary Scale: £26,869 - £28,998 per annum pro-rata

We have an exciting opportunity for an Occupational Therapy Support Worker to join our occupational team at the Carseview Centre. Carseview provides and supports recovery-focused services for in-patients with acute and/or enduring mental health problems.

We are looking for a committed individual who enjoys working in a challenging environment as part of a multidisciplinary team and contributing to recovery-focused service delivery. Essential qualities include being open, approachable, responsible, and able to support excellent team working and interpersonal relationships to develop high performance and ensure the best care experience.

About NHS Tayside: NHS Tayside is a Values-Based Organisation, committed to the values of NHS Scotland:

  • Dignity and Respect
  • Openness, Honesty, and Responsibility
  • Quality and Teamwork
  • Care and Compassion

We offer a structured staff review system and are committed to regular in-service training and personal and professional development. The post will be supervised by the Lead Occupational Therapist for adult inpatient mental health at Carseview.
